Captain Deepak Singh Martyred, Pakistani Terrorist Gunned Down in J&K

by Antariksh Singh

In a tragic turn of events, the Indian Army has lost another brave soul in the ongoing struggle against terrorism in Jammu and Kashmir. Captain Deepak Singh, serving with the Army’s Counter Insurgency Force, was martyred during a fierce encounter with terrorists in the Assar forest area of Doda district on Wednesday. The clash also resulted in the elimination of a terrorist, reportedly of Pakistani origin.

This latest encounter marks the fourth significant engagement in recent days within the Udhampuri-Doda-Kishtwar region. The series of confrontations began on Tuesday when a group of at least four terrorists initiated hostilities with the security forces. Despite initial exchanges of gunfire, the terrorists managed to evade capture, leading to a protracted search operation that continued into Wednesday.

During the intense firefight on Wednesday morning, Captain Singh sustained critical injuries and was airlifted to a military hospital. Sadly, he succumbed to his wounds despite the best efforts of medical personnel. Captain Singh, a native of Dehradun in Uttarakhand, is remembered as a dedicated officer whose sacrifice has deeply affected the military community.

This incident further compounds the Army’s losses in the region, with ten soldiers having been martyred since July. Earlier this summer, five soldiers were killed in an ambush on July 8 in Machedi, Kathua district, and four more, including another Captain, lost their lives on July 15 in the Desa forest area of Doda.

Following Wednesday’s encounter, Army and J&K Police forces discovered an M4 carbine and four backpacks at the scene. Blood stains at the location indicated that one of the terrorists had been injured. Subsequently, another encounter took place where the injured terrorist was confirmed dead. An AK-47 was recovered from the site of this engagement.

In response to the loss of Captain Singh, the Jammu-based White Knight Corps issued a heartfelt statement: “All ranks salute the supreme sacrifice of braveheart Capt Deepak Singh who succumbed to his injuries. White Knight Corps offers deepest condolences and stands firm with the bereaved family in this hour of grief.”

The operation to root out remaining terrorists in the Assar forest continues. The area, a crucial junction close to the borders of Udhampur and Ramban districts, remains under heavy scrutiny as forces track down the remaining insurgents. Lt Gen MV Suchindra Kumar, GOC-in-C of Army’s Northern Command, visited the forward locations in Doda and Kishtwar earlier this week to assess the situation and bolster ongoing counter-terrorism efforts.
